Understanding Sleep Apnea and Its Impact

Sleep apnea is a condition where breathing repeatedly stops and starts during sleep. Obstructive sleep apnea occurs when throat muscles relax and block your airway, while central sleep apnea happens when your brain doesn’t send proper signals to the muscles controlling breathing. These breathing interruptions can happen hundreds of times per night, preventing you from reaching the deep, restorative sleep your body needs.

The impact of untreated sleep apnea extends far beyond feeling tired. Sleep apnea is associated with serious health risks, including cardiovascular complications, high blood pressure, stroke, and cognitive impairment. Many people with sleep apnea don’t realize they have it, as the most noticeable symptoms occur during sleep. Partners often report loud snoring, gasping, or breathing pauses the affected person may not be aware of experiencing.

Recognizing Sleep Apnea Symptoms

Sleep apnea symptoms vary from person to person but typically include excessive daytime sleepiness, loud snoring, observed breathing interruptions during sleep, morning headaches, difficulty concentrating, irritability, and waking with a dry mouth or sore throat. For children, symptoms may include bedwetting, night terrors, poor school performance, and behavioral issues.

Oral Appliance Therapy for Sleep Apnea

As dental sleep medicine specialists, we excel in providing custom-fitted oral appliances for patients with sleep-disordered breathing. These specially designed devices work by repositioning your jaw and tongue to maintain an open airway during sleep. Management of sleep apnea patients who are candidates for oral appliance therapy involves the selection, fabrication, fitting, and calibration of devices worn during sleep, requiring qualified dentists with knowledge and experience in overall oral health care, the temporomandibular joint, dental occlusion, and associated oral structures.

CPAP and Combination Therapy Options

Continuous Positive Airway Pressure therapy remains an effective treatment for moderate to severe sleep apnea. This treatment involves wearing a mask during sleep delivering a constant flow of pressurized air to keep your airway open. We provide guidance on CPAP mask fitting and ongoing compliance support to help you adjust to therapy.

For some patients, combination therapy blending oral appliance therapy with CPAP or other interventions provides optimal results. We also offer Bi-PAP therapy as an alternative for patients who cannot tolerate traditional CPAP, providing two pressure levels making breathing more comfortable.
